How Much Does Fiber Cement Siding Cost Compared to Vinyl?

Fiber cement siding averages $21,500 nationally while vinyl siding averages $18,000 — making both strong investments for Greater Boston homeowners. Suffolk County residents choosing between these materials get exceptional value either way.
